‘Human Rights Issues’ in India: US Report

  • This is an annual exercise led by a bureau within the State Department and is mandated by the US Congress.
  • It has listed significant human rights issues in India in 2022.
  • This includes unlawful and arbitrary killing, freedom of press and violence targeting religious and ethnic minorities.
  • It mentions human rights violations such as extrajudicial killings, torture or cruel, inhuman, or degrading treatment or punishment by police and prison officials, and harsh and life-threatening prison conditions.
